How common are plane crashes in 2020?

Large commercial airplanes had 0.27 fatal accidents per million flights in 2020 , To70 said, or one fatal crash every 3.7 million flights — up from 0.18 fatal accidents per million flights in 2019. The decline in crashes came amid a sharp decline in flights due to the coronavirus pandemic.

What plane crash happened in 2020?

On the evening of August 7, 2020, Air India Express Flight 1344 crashed with 190 people on board during a botched landing attempt at Kozhikode Calicut International Airport. Eighteen people were killed in the Air India crash and more than 150 others sustained injuries.

What are the chances of dying in a plane crash 2020?

The annual risk of being killed in a plane crash for the average American is about 1 in 11 million . On that basis, the risk looks pretty small. Compare that, for example, to the annual risk of being killed in a motor vehicle crash for the average American, which is about 1 in 5,000.

How many planes crashed in 2019 in the US?

Preliminary estimates of the total number of accidents involving a U.S.-registered civilian aircraft decreased from 1,347 in 2018 to 1,302 in 2019. The number of civil aviation deaths increased from 395 in 2018 to 452 in 2019. All but 8 of the 452 deaths in 2019 were .

Which plane has the most crashes?

520: The crash of Japan Airlines Flight 123 on August 12, 1985, is the single-aircraft disaster with the highest number of fatalities: 520 people died on board a Boeing 747 .

Did anyone survive the 911 plane crash?

Stanley Praimnath (born October 27, 1956) is a survivor of the September 11 attacks on the World Trade Center. He worked as an executive for Fuji Bank on the 81st floor of the South Tower (WTC 2), the second tower struck that day. He was one of only 18 survivors from within or above the plane's impact zone.

What airline has never had a crash?

Qantas holds the distinction of being the only airline that Dustin Hoffman's character in the 1988 movie “Rain Man” would fly because it had “never crashed.” The airline suffered fatal crashes of small aircraft prior to 1951, but has had no fatalities in the 70 years since.

Can you survive a plane crash?

Contrary to movie and media portrayals, it is highly possible to survive a plane crash . According to the most recent report on the subject published by the National Transportation Safety Board (NTSB), the passenger survival rate for plane crashes between 1983 and 2000 was 95.7%.

What year had the most airplane crashes?

The greatest number of fatalities involving one aircraft occurred in 1985 , when 520 people died in the crash of Japan Airlines Flight 123. The most fatalities in any aviation accident in history occurred during 1977 in the Tenerife airport disaster, when 583 people were killed when two Boeing 747s collided on a runway.
